|
DataCopy - пожелания пользователей
Установка, Справочная система
Опция | Комментарий | Реализация |
При первом запуске сделать возможность добавления программы в меню автозагрузки
| Функция для ленивых :-) Скорее всего, когда будет инсталляция программы - тогда и реализуется. | В будущем |
Сделать описание программы, в идеале - человеческий Help | Уже есть chm файл, осталось интегрировать с программой. | В версии 0.9 |
Ведение логов
Опция | Комментарий | Реализация |
И в логе чтобы был список измененных (читай скопированных) файлов. |
По всей видимости необходимо вводить систему UNIX - уровней отладки - простой лог, более сложный, детальный и тд. Если это очень актуально - пишите. | Частично реализовано. При установке Ведение расширенного лог файла. |
Вести журнал изменений в папках (ОЧЕНЬ Важно !!!).
Пример: (10.05.2003 - Папка Такая
Файлы такие и столько
Изменение размера +/- столько
Кол-во файлов +/- столько
!!! В данной папке на сегодняшнюю дату были
удалены файлы * такие * ),
т.е. должен быть журнал итогов за контрольный период - год
,неделя, день, час, минута, сек. - ПО ВЫБОРУ !!!
| Если очень надо - пишите, пока отозвался только один человек | Реализация во вторую очередь |
Функциональность
Опция | Комментарий | Реализация |
Что на мой взгляд, в программе должен быть ВЫБОР (в настройках):
1. Обновлять или нет ранее записанные ИНДЕНТИЧНЫЕ ПО НАЗВАНИЮ файлы;
2. Измененные копии ранее записанных файлов писать по измененным
именем : ~1...до бесконечности (чтобы была возможность иметь полный
архив изменений проектов и файлов);
3. Различать изменение файлов в большую и меньшую сторону (это важно
!!!)
4. * ВАЖНО * Уметь работать с файлами *.zip, *.zif (надо чтобы при
записи *.zip, можно было не переписывать тотже файл *.zif, и чтобы эти папки не
проявлялись просьбой "над ли записывать, то что ранее было записано ?")
| Буду думать. Если это необходимо - пишите. | Не знаю |
2. В окне EditWatchForm ввести (дополнить) возможность вводить данные с клавиатуры и из буфера обмена.
А в дальнейшем хорошо бы ввести возможность копирования с архивацией, используя архиватор(ы) пользователя.
| Буду делать | Во вторую очередь |
Научи ее запоминать размеры,а то в XP выглядит не хорошо
| Буду делать | Во вторую очередь |
часто закрываю программу на крестик
привык что в прогах есть настройка: сворачивать в трей при закритии
yes/no
| Ок | Вскоре |
- вообщем то мне (это мое личное мнение, у других наверое другое) запуск прог после
завершения синхронизации не очень нужен, точнее говоря совсем не нужен,но былы бы
очень хорошо по системным часам запускать какую-нибудь прогу, типа "архиватор",
которая засовывала бы все синхронизированные папки от юзверей в один файл (вообщем-то
на это способен любой, правильно настроеный, архиватор, а потом этот файл копировался
куда-нибудь на стриммер (это задача уже других прог), что обеспечивало бы 100%
гарантированную от всяких тама внених воздействий архивацию данных. Причем этот
процесс настолько "интимный" :), что наверное подавляющее большинство админов
предпочло бы, что бы он происходил часа в 2 ночи, отсюдова и пожелание видеть запуск в
определенное время, хотя этим может заняться и штатный виндовый планировщик
- а как бы назначать синхронизацию данных в определенное время, а то раз день конечно
удобно, но возникает вопрос, а когда именно раз в день, мне бы как бы лучше вечером,
что бы работу юзверей за день архивировать, ну а вообще в идеале, конечно, расписание
по времени, ну например тама в 13.30 - обед, 17.30 - окончание рабочего дня, ну и т.д.
| Ок | Ближе к 1 версии |
желательно чтобы во первых программа обновляла не все
файлы из sourse folder а только те которые уже лежат но устарели в
destination также неплохо добавить сохранение резервной копию
обновляемых файлов и переименовывание по шаблону.
Например у меня два файла разного содержания но одинаковое название на
сети. Раньше я тупо обновлял каждый день и переименовывал в другое
название один из них а так я задал дир и сказал что его обновлять под
названием таким то.
e:\dir\dcl.dbf copy c:\dir\dcl.dbf
e:\dir2003\dcl.dbf rename c:\dir\olddcl.dbf
| Потребует изменения формата файла заданийю Если актуально - пишите | Позже |
Плохо, что программа в одном задании не
позволяет выделить несколько папок-источников, откуда копировать. Если
я резервирую целый диск с десятком папок, то создавать "Вотч" на каждую
папку неудобно. Соответственно, нужно предусмотреть удобный способ
куда эти папки копировать в одном задании, предоставить возможность
запихнуть из все в одну папку на архивном диске или же прямо вывалить
на архивный диск как есть. О сжатии я не говорю, это, вероятно, здесь
не нужно. Иначе чем ваша программа будет отличаться от
микрософтовского виндоусовфского Бэкапа? Дядьку Билла Гейтса вы все
равно не переплюнете, следовательно, надо бороться за простоту,
красивое оформление,удобство и надежность. Почему у вас кот какой-то
невыразительно серый? Далее, есть проблемка, я не знаю, решаема ли
она. Предположим, Ворд или другой редактор записал в атрибутах
созданного им файла последнюю дату создания или модифицирования файла.
Тогда, если со времени последнего модифицирования родным редактором файл им не
менялся и тем не менее по сравнению с предыдущим архивированием его
размер отличается, это значит, что файл испорчен вирусом или каким-то
тараканом залезшим на диск. Ваша программа должна отслеживать это
(где-то хранить информацию о датах модифицирования, датах последнего
резервировагния и размерах файлов) и
выдать предупреждение о возможной порче файла, предоставив
пользователю возможность отказаться от его копирования до выяснения
обстоятельств. Чтобы испорченным файлом не заменить хороший.
| Такое надо? | |
Неплохо бы релизовать копирование самой Watch, несколько
неудобно вводить 20 раз адрес, различающийся 1 цифрой (user1,2,3)
| Такое надо? | |
DataCopy - Мои планы
- Сделать русскую версию интерфейса
- Улучшить файл помощи
- Интегрировать работу с архиватором (бекап в zip архив)
- Сделать программу поиска дублирующихся файлов
|